Mmm, but that score was everyone. And you only got a certain amount of points for it in the grand scheme of things. The reason low HP pets were able to defeat Razul (was that his name? o.O) was that it was set up that way. You could only win if you had the weapon from the tomb. If you used that weapon against him, you won instantly.

The thing is, if your pet is too weak to fight, bow out gracefully. Losses don't count towards points; they only lag up the Battledome. I'm sure everyone's noticed how much calmer the BD is - certainly, there is still some lag, but it is nowhere near as bad as when the first wave was around. Dirtside, aka Mr. Insane, has posted on the boards, telling people not to fight just because they can, when their pets are so weak that they die on the first blast.

That's not to say you haven't put a considerable effort into training. I'm impressed ;) But I'm just pointing out that the 100,100 points were there for a reason, and there was a reason weak pets could beat that challenger.
